Off the line, the A110 S 292 hits 100 km/h in 3.93 s versus 4.73 s for the Bmw 840d xDrive. At this point, the A110 S 292 leads by 0.80 s and sits roughly 7 m ahead.
At 200 metres, the A110 S 292 is doing 154 km/h against 142 km/h for the Bmw 840d xDrive. The gap is 0.59 s. The challenger starts to claw back ground.
At 400 metres standing start, the A110 S 292 crosses the line in 12.08 s versus 13.00 s. The 0.91 s gap represents roughly 44 m of track — a gap visible to the naked eye.
Past 400 metres, the A110 S 292 continues to build its lead. At 600 metres, it runs at 210 km/h versus 198 km/h. At 1,000 metres, the A110 S 292 finishes in 22.15 s versus 23.58 s, with a 1.43 s lead. Both vehicles have similar top speeds (250 (i.e. 155 mph — industry threshold) vs 264 km/h), preventing any comeback.
Electronically capped at 250 (i.e. 155 mph — industry threshold) km/h, the Bmw 840d xDrive never reaches its natural aerodynamic ceiling in this duel. That’s not a physical limit of the motor — it’s a deliberate manufacturer decision, typically tied to standard-fit tyre ratings or model-range positioning.
With two combustion powertrains, the difference comes down to power-to-weight ratio (5.63 kg/hp vs 3.76 kg/hp) and transmission (Automatic vs Automatic).
In European road use (130 km/h max), both vehicles reach the legal speed limit in under 7.26 seconds. The 0.80 s difference in 0 to 100 km/h is mostly felt in motorway merging and overtaking.
